logo

Output 9e64bf26418b415dbfbec70b19e4920835fbe2224a332e1803fd990a88cf774d:0

value
1635692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ba8fbdbb1e71a5da7a419f617ff2d711fcb9209 OP_EQUAL
address
3JoGicnQuxACvNzcA8kGBHCPuurcw73ZJ6
transaction
9e64bf26418b415dbfbec70b19e4920835fbe2224a332e1803fd990a88cf774d